New Critical Vulnerabilities Found on Nucleus TCP/IP Stack

Forescout Research Labs, with support from Medigate Labs, have discovered a set of 13 new vulnerabilities affecting the Nucleus TCP/IP stack, which we are collectively calling NUCLEUS:13. The new vulnerabilities allow for remote code execution, denial of service, and information leak. Nucleus is used in safety-critical devices, such as anesthesia machines, patient monitors and others in healthcare.

NUCLEUS:13 - Dissecting the Nucleus TCP/IP stack

In the fifth study of Project Memoria – NUCLEUS:13 – Forescout Research Labs and Medigate identified a set of 13 new vulnerabilities affecting the Nucleus TCP/IP stack. Nucleus is currently owned by Siemens. Its original release was in 1993 and, since then, it has been deployed in many industry verticals with safety and security requirements such as medical devices, automotive, and industrial systems. Upon identification of the new vulnerabilities, Forescout Research Labs and Medigate collaborated with Siemens, CISA, CERT/CC and other agencies to confirm the findings and notify vendors.
